ntcProtTsOIpInConfTable
table.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.3
·
1 row entry
·
14 columns
Configuration table
A conceptual row of the ntcProtTsOIpInConfTable.
Indexes
ntcProtTsOIpInConfName
| Column | Syntax | OID | ||||||||||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
|
ntcProtTsOIpInConfName
Name of the configuration
|
OctetString Constraints: range: 1-32 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.3.1.1 |
||||||||||
|
ntcProtTsOIpInInpSelection
Select the input interface for the TS over IP functionality.
|
Enumerationr/w Enumerated Values:
|
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.3.1.2 |
||||||||||
|
ntcProtTsOIpInTsEncapProtocol
Encapsulation protocol used for the received TS over IP functionality (UDP,
RTP and RTP with FEC). |
Enumerationr/w Enumerated Values:
|
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.3.1.3 |
||||||||||
|
ntcProtTsOIpInIpAddressType
Configuration of the IP address type for TS over IP reception. (unicast or
multicast) |
Enumerationr/w Enumerated Values:
|
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.3.1.4 |
||||||||||
|
ntcProtTsOIpInMulticastAddress
Define the multicast IP address used to receive the TS over IP data
functionality. Regular expression : (?-mix:^\d{1,3}\.\d{1,3}\.\d{1,3}\.\d{1,3}$) |
SNMPv2-SMIIpAddressr/w Textual Convention: SNMPv2-SMIIpAddress OctetStringType Constraints: range: 4 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.3.1.5 |
||||||||||
|
ntcProtTsOIpInMulticastSourceA
Multicast source Address. Regular expression :
(?-mix:^\d{1,3}\.\d{1,3}\.\d{1,3}\.\d{1,3}$) |
NEWTEC-TC-MIBNtcNetworkAddressr/w Textual Convention: NEWTEC-TC-MIBNtcNetworkAddress OctetStringType Constraints: range: 7..18 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.3.1.6 |
||||||||||
|
ntcProtTsOIpInMulticastSourceB
Multicast source Address. Regular expression :
(?-mix:^\d{1,3}\.\d{1,3}\.\d{1,3}\.\d{1,3}$) |
NEWTEC-TC-MIBNtcNetworkAddressr/w Textual Convention: NEWTEC-TC-MIBNtcNetworkAddress OctetStringType Constraints: range: 7..18 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.3.1.7 |
||||||||||
|
ntcProtTsOIpInUdpPort
Configure the UDP port on which the TS over IP stream is received.
|
Unsigned32r/w Constraints: range: 1-65535 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.3.1.8 |
||||||||||
|
ntcProtTsOIpInTrafficProfile
Configure the TS input traffic profile for the TS stream (CBR=constant or
VBR=variable bitrate). |
Enumerationr/w Enumerated Values:
|
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.3.1.9 |
||||||||||
|
ntcProtTsOIpInInputRateType
When the operator selects 'User Defined', the actual input rate and the
control loop type needs to be specified further. In the other case, PCR PID and control loop type is used. |
Enumerationr/w Enumerated Values:
|
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.3.1.10 |
||||||||||
|
ntcProtTsOIpInAutoPcrDetection
Enable or disable Auto PCR Detection.
|
NEWTEC-TC-MIBNtcEnabler/w Textual Convention: NEWTEC-TC-MIBNtcEnable EnumerationType Values:
|
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.3.1.11 |
||||||||||
|
ntcProtTsOIpInPcrPid
PCR PID.
|
Unsigned32r/w Constraints: range: 0-8191 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.3.1.12 |
||||||||||
|
ntcProtTsOIpInMaxBufferDelay
The maximum delay introduced by the device to compensate jitter introduced by
the IP network. This is only relevant for CBR traffic. |
msSNMPv2-SMIUnsigned32r/w Textual Convention: SNMPv2-SMIUnsigned32 Unsigned32Type Constraints: range: 0..4294967295 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.3.1.13 |
||||||||||
|
ntcProtTsOIpInInputTsBitRate
TS input rate in bps used with a constant bitrate input traffic profile.
Current devices support a range of 10 to 250000000 bps. |
bpsSNMPv2-SMIUnsigned32r/w Textual Convention: SNMPv2-SMIUnsigned32 Unsigned32Type Constraints: range: 0..4294967295 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.3.1.14 |
ntcProtTsOIpInMonTable
table.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.4.5
·
1 row entry
·
18 columns
Monitoring table
A conceptual row of the ntcProtTsOIpInMonTable.
Indexes
ntcProtTsOIpInMonName
| Column | Syntax | OID |
|---|---|---|
|
ntcProtTsOIpInMonName
Name of the output monitor
|
OctetString Constraints: range: 0-32 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.4.5.1.1 |
|
ntcProtTsOIpInMonMeasInTsBitRate
Displays the measured TS over IP input TS bit rate in bps.
|
bpsSNMPv2-SMIUnsigned32 Textual Convention: SNMPv2-SMIUnsigned32 Unsigned32Type Constraints: range: 0..4294967295 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.4.5.1.2 |
|
ntcProtTsOIpInMonBufferDelay
The delay introduced by the device to compensate the jitter introduced by the
IP network. This is only relevant for CBR traffic. |
msSNMPv2-SMIUnsigned32 Textual Convention: SNMPv2-SMIUnsigned32 Unsigned32Type Constraints: range: 0..4294967295 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.4.5.1.3 |
|
ntcProtTsOIpInMonMinBufferFill
The measured minimum buffer delay in the buffer which compensate the jitter of
the IP network. This is only relevant for CBR traffic. |
msSNMPv2-SMIUnsigned32 Textual Convention: SNMPv2-SMIUnsigned32 Unsigned32Type Constraints: range: 0..4294967295 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.4.5.1.4 |
|
ntcProtTsOIpInMonMaxBufferFill
The measured maximum buffer delay in the buffer which compensate the jitter of
the IP network. This is only relevant for CBR traffic. |
msSNMPv2-SMIUnsigned32 Textual Convention: SNMPv2-SMIUnsigned32 Unsigned32Type Constraints: range: 0..4294967295 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.4.5.1.5 |
|
ntcProtTsOIpInMonSourceInfo
Displays the IP address (and UDP port) of the source that is generating the TS
over IP traffic. |
OctetString Constraints: range: 0-32 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.4.5.1.6 |
|
ntcProtTsOIpInMonRtpFecScheme
Displays the type of Rtp FEC Scheme currently used (if any).
|
OctetString Constraints: range: 0-32 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.4.5.1.7 |
|
ntcProtTsOIpInMonTsInCount
Displays the Number of received TS packets in UDP mode.
|
packetsSNMPv2-SMICounter32 Textual Convention: SNMPv2-SMICounter32 Unsigned32Type Constraints: range: 0..4294967295 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.4.5.1.8 |
|
ntcProtTsOIpInMonRtpInCount
Displays the number of received RTP packets. (only applicable when RTP is
used) |
packetsSNMPv2-SMICounter32 Textual Convention: SNMPv2-SMICounter32 Unsigned32Type Constraints: range: 0..4294967295 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.4.5.1.9 |
|
ntcProtTsOIpInMonRtpColFecInCnt
Displays the number of received (input) RTP column FEC packets.
|
packetsSNMPv2-SMICounter32 Textual Convention: SNMPv2-SMICounter32 Unsigned32Type Constraints: range: 0..4294967295 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.4.5.1.10 |
|
ntcProtTsOIpInMonRtpRowFecInCnt
Displays the number of received RTP row FEC packets. (Only applicable when RTP
with FEC is used.) |
packetsSNMPv2-SMICounter32 Textual Convention: SNMPv2-SMICounter32 Unsigned32Type Constraints: range: 0..4294967295 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.4.5.1.11 |
|
ntcProtTsOIpInMonTsOutCount
Displays the number of valid TS packets leaving the TS over IP input
processing. |
packetsSNMPv2-SMICounter32 Textual Convention: SNMPv2-SMICounter32 Unsigned32Type Constraints: range: 0..4294967295 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.4.5.1.12 |
|
ntcProtTsOIpInMonTsDropCount
Number of dropped TS packets. (When RTP is used the number of dropped TS
packets in the RTP frame is counted.) |
packetsSNMPv2-SMICounter32 Textual Convention: SNMPv2-SMICounter32 Unsigned32Type Constraints: range: 0..4294967295 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.4.5.1.13 |
|
ntcProtTsOIpInMonTsOverflowCount
Displays the number of TS packets that are dropped because of an overflow
situation. |
packetsSNMPv2-SMICounter32 Textual Convention: SNMPv2-SMICounter32 Unsigned32Type Constraints: range: 0..4294967295 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.4.5.1.14 |
|
ntcProtTsOIpInMonRtpDropCount
Displays the number of dropped RTP packets. (This is only applicable when RTP
is used.) |
packetsSNMPv2-SMICounter32 Textual Convention: SNMPv2-SMICounter32 Unsigned32Type Constraints: range: 0..4294967295 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.4.5.1.15 |
|
ntcProtTsOIpInMonRtpFecDropCount
Displays the number of dropped uncorrectable packets. (This is only applicable
when RTP-FEC is used.) |
packetsSNMPv2-SMICounter32 Textual Convention: SNMPv2-SMICounter32 Unsigned32Type Constraints: range: 0..4294967295 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.4.5.1.16 |
|
ntcProtTsOIpInMonRtpRepairCount
Displays the number of repaired RTP packets by using the received FEC
information. (This is only applicable for RTP with FEC) |
packetsSNMPv2-SMICounter32 Textual Convention: SNMPv2-SMICounter32 Unsigned32Type Constraints: range: 0..4294967295 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.4.5.1.17 |
|
ntcProtTsOIpInActivePcrPid
Active PCR PID.
|
Unsigned32 Constraints: range: 0-8190 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.4.5.1.18 |

Alarm status table
A conceptual row of the ntcProtTsOIpInAlarmStatusTable.
Indexes
ntcProtTsOIpInAlarmStatusName
| Column | Syntax | OID | ||||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
|
ntcProtTsOIpInAlarmStatusName
Name of the alarm monitor
|
OctetString Constraints: range: 0-32 |
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.5.1.1.1 |
||||
|
ntcProtTsOIpInNoInputData
This alarm is raised when no input data is received for at least one of the
the redundant TS over IP inputs. This variable indicates the current status of the alarm. |
NEWTEC-TC-MIBNtcAlarmState Textual Convention: NEWTEC-TC-MIBNtcAlarmState EnumerationType Values:
|
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.5.1.1.2 |
||||
|
ntcProtTsOIpInBufferUnderflow
This alarm is raised when the input data buffer is below the minimum value.
This variable indicates the current status of the alarm. |
NEWTEC-TC-MIBNtcAlarmState Textual Convention: NEWTEC-TC-MIBNtcAlarmState EnumerationType Values:
|
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.5.1.1.3 |
||||
|
ntcProtTsOIpInBufferOverflow
This alarm is raised when the input data buffer of TS over IP is full. This
variable indicates the current status of the alarm. |
NEWTEC-TC-MIBNtcAlarmState Textual Convention: NEWTEC-TC-MIBNtcAlarmState EnumerationType Values:
|
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.5.1.1.4 |
||||
|
ntcProtTsOIpInRtpNoSync
This alarm is raised when no valid RTP input data is received. This variable
indicates the current status of the alarm. |
NEWTEC-TC-MIBNtcAlarmState Textual Convention: NEWTEC-TC-MIBNtcAlarmState EnumerationType Values:
|
.1.3.6.1.4.1.5835.5.2.9400.1.5.1.1.5 |
